A 32-year-old male asked:
Blood in urine on and off for a month. had blood tests, 3 urine analysis, cystoscopy, 2 kidney and bladder ultrasounds. still haven't found cause.

CT: Some small calculi may not be visualized with ultrasound. They may not obstruct the kidney, but any movement may turn urine positive for blood. So before everyone throws their hands up and says " I don't know ", try CT. Best wishes
